On 19/06/2023 14:27:04+0100, Richard Purdie wrote:
> On Mon, 2023-06-19 at 15:18 +0200, Alexander Kanavin wrote:
> > Should the regex that finds these lines be fixed rather? It’s
> > entirely valid to say ‘upstream status’ somewhere, it should be
> > matching ‘Upstream-Status:’ at the start of the line exactly.
> 
> The check is deliberately doing fuzzy matching to spot "broken" lines.
> Whether we need that any more now we have other checks for correct
> lines is probably a better question...
> 

Yeah, this was my assumption that doing fuzzy matching was expected.
